Main issues, as the Inspector framed them

  • the effect of the development on the character and appearance of the area
  • whether the proposed development would provide acceptable living conditions for the occupants of the neighbouring properties, in particular 45 Westminster Road with regard to overlooking and loss of privacy to the garden
  • the effect of the development on biodiversity and the requirement for 10% Biodiversity Net Gain (BNG)

What decided it

The reduction of the gap between properties would be harmful to the character and appearance of the area by disrupting the rhythm of gaps between corner properties that form part of the estate's character.

the environmental harm to character and appearance substantially outweighed the limited benefits of one additional dwelling

Plan policies cited: Policy SWDPR 28, Policy SWDPR 35
